Comprehending Coffee Beans: Types and Ranges



When diving into the globe of coffee, comprehending the kinds and ranges of coffee beans is essential for every single enthusiast. You'll largely come across two major types: Arabica and Robusta. Arabica beans are known for their smooth, complex flavors and reduced caffeine material, making them a favored among coffee aficionados. On the various other hand, Robusta beans pack a punch with a more powerful, much more bitter preference and higher high levels of caffeine degrees, typically made use of in espresso blends.Within these varieties, you'll find different local varieties, each bringing special characteristics. For circumstances, Ethiopian Yirgacheffe supplies bright flower notes, while Colombian beans give a well-balanced flavor account. As you discover, remember to take notice of processing techniques like washed or all-natural, as they can considerably influence the last preference. By acquainting on your own with these beans and their tastes, you'll elevate your coffee experience and make even more enlightened selections in your brewing journey.

Handling Methods Discussed



The following crucial step is processing them to transform those vivid fruits right into the beans you'll brew once you have actually gathered your coffee cherries. There are two main approaches: the damp process and the dry procedure. In the dry procedure, you spread out the cherries out in the sun to dry, enabling the fruit to ferment and impart one-of-a-kind tastes to the beans. On the various other hand, the damp process includes eliminating the fruit instantly and fermenting the beans in water, leading to a cleaner taste. After processing, the beans are hulled, sorted, and usually dried out again. Each technique impacts the taste profile, so try out both can assist you find your preferred mixture. Comprehending these techniques is vital to appreciating your coffee experience.

Roast Degrees Discussed



Roast levels play a crucial role fit the flavor profile of your coffee. When you select a light roast, you'll enjoy bright acidity and fruity notes. As you relocate to a medium roast, you'll discover a balance of sweet taste and intricacy, typically highlighting delicious chocolate or caramel flavors. Dark roasts, on the various other hand, supply strong, smoky qualities with much less acidity, making them abundant and robust. Each level results from different roasting times and temperature levels, affecting the beans' chemical structure. By recognizing these levels, you can better choose a coffee that matches your preference choices. Try out different roasts to discover which one resonates with you, enhancing your overall coffee experience and satisfaction.

Taste Growth Refine



As you check out the flavor advancement process, you'll uncover that toasting methods play an important function fit the preference account of your coffee. The roasting temperature level and time straight affect the level of acidity, sweetness, and anger of the beans. Light roasts retain even more of the bean's initial flavors, highlighting flower and fruity notes. Tool roasts balance level of acidity and body, offering an all-round flavor. Dark roasts, on the various other hand, highlight vibrant, great smoky characteristics while reducing the bean's integral top qualities. Throughout toasting, chain reactions, like the Maillard response and caramelization, transform the beans and boost their complexity. Trying out various roasting levels can assist you discover your excellent mixture, so do not be reluctant to taste and find the abundant spectrum of flavors!


Espresso vs. Blended Coffee: Trick Distinctions



Espresso and combined coffee each deal one-of-a-kind experiences that satisfy various tastes and choices. Espresso is a focused coffee brewed forcibly warm water via finely-ground coffee beans, resulting in a rich, bold flavor and a luscious layer of crema on top. It's typically enjoyed as a shot or utilized as a base for drinks like cappucinos and cappuccinos.On the other hand, mixed coffee combines different beans from various regions, producing a more well balanced flavor profile. You'll often discover blends that highlight sweet taste, acidity, or body, making them flexible for various brewing approaches. While espresso concentrates on strength, combined coffee may use a wider series of tastes that can alter with each sip.Ultimately, your selection between espresso and combined coffee boils down to your personal choice. Whether you hunger for a fast jolt or a leisurely mug, both alternatives have something tasty to supply.

Tips for Choose and Storage Coffee Beans



Keeping and selecting coffee beans appropriately can substantially boost your brewing experience. Begin by picking top quality beans that suit your taste. Look for freshness; beans roasted within the last 2 weeks are ideal. Examine the roast date on the packaging, and acquire from reputable roasters or local shops.Once you have your beans, store them in an impermeable container to stop exposure to light, dampness, and air. A dark, amazing location works best, so prevent keeping them in the fridge or freezer, as this can present moisture. Only grind the amount you require to keep freshness; entire beans retain flavor longer than pre-ground coffee.Lastly, attempt to use your beans within two to 4 weeks after opening up for peak taste. Following these tips will certainly guarantee your coffee stays savory and enjoyable, elevating your daily brew to brand-new elevations.
